1. Introduction of L-Valine
L-Valine, with the IUPAC Name of (2S)-2-amino-3-methylbutanoic acid, is one kind of white crystalline powder. This belongs to the Product Categories which include Amino Acids;Amino Acid Derivatives;Valine [Val, V];Amino Acids and Derivatives;alpha-Amino Acids;Biochemistry;Nutritional Supplements;Amino Acids.
2. Properties of L-Valine
L-Valine has the following datas: (1)Index of Refraction: 1.461; (2)Molar Refractivity: 30.23 cm3; (3)Molar Volume: 110.1 cm3; (4)Polarizability: 11.98×10-24cm3; (5)Surface Tension: 39.8 dyne/cm; (6)Density: 1.063 g/cm3; (7)Flash Point: 83 °C; (8)Enthalpy of Vaporization: 49.58 kJ/mol; (9)Melting Point: 295-300 °C (subl.)(lit.); (10)Boiling Point: 213.6 °C at 760 mmHg; (11)Vapour Pressure: 0.0633 mmHg at 25°C; (12)Water Solubility: 85 g/L (20 oC).
3. Structure Descriptors of L-Valine
You could convert the following datas into the molecular structure:
(1)Canonical SMILES: CC(C)C(C(=O)O)N
(2)Isomeric SMILES: CC(C)[C@@H](C(=O)O)N
(3)InChI: InChI=1S/C5H11NO2/c1-3(2)4(6)5(7)8/h3-4H,6H2,1-2H3,(H,7,8)/t4-/m0/s1
(4)InChIKey: KZSNJWFQEVHDMF-BYPYZUCNSA-N
